Witch (Hope & Fear)

About this class

Witches are magical practitioners who commune with the forces of nature and entities from realms beyond. These spellcasters call forth power through craft, combining the tangible and ephemeral by casting spells, murmuring incantations, creating talismans, weaving illusions, and maintaining other personalized practices. They can protect their allies and harm their enemies by invoking powerful forces beyond themselves—supernatural beings such as ancestors, deities, or aspects of nature. Often, their magical knowledge is passed down from these entities or through many generations of practitioners who gather in small groups known as covens. Witches are frequently feared and misunderstood, as their methods can appear mysterious, strange, and even macabre to the uninitiated. Whichever path they walk, a witch treads the boundary between light and shadow without fear.

Starting stats

Evasion
10
Hit points
6

Hope feature

Witch's Charm
When you or an ally within Far range fails an action roll, you can spend 3 Hope to change it into a success with Fear instead

Class features

  • Hex

    Mark a Stress to temporarily Hex a target within Far range. While Hexed, the target gains a penalty to their damage rolls and Difficulty equal to your tier. The maximum number of creatures you can Hex at one time is equal to your Spellcast trait.

  • Commune

    Once per long rest during a moment of calm, you can commune with an ancestor, a deity, a spirit, or an otherworldly being. Ask them a question, then roll a number of d6s equal to your Spellcast trait. Choose one of the results and reference the chart below for the effect.

    Roll Effect
    1-3 You taste a flavor, smell a scent, or feel a sensation relevant to the answer.
    4-5 You Hear Souds or see a vision relevant to the answer.
    6 You physically experience a scene relevant to the answer as if you were there.
